## Releases

Quick note for the sync: the nightly search reindex on Mossgate now ships as its own release artifact instead of piggybacking on the API deploy. It runs at 01:30, takes ~20 minutes, and rolls back automatically on checksum mismatch. Artifacts must be signed before the runner will touch them. The key we sign reindex artifacts with is below.

release key, bagep-yajof: bky19_xtqFhCW5hRYj5CXT2ZJ

# Break-Glass Access — Fennick Resolver Incident Path

When the Fennick edge resolvers flap (symptom: intermittent NXDOMAIN for internal zones, recovering within seconds), standard dashboards may themselves fail to resolve. In that case, break-glass access to the Oakhurst admin bastion is authorized for any maintainer on rotation. First confirm the flakiness via the static-IP probe host, capture a packet trace, and log the incident in the Harlowe register. To unlock the bastion's offline credential store, use the phrase recorded directly below.

unlock words, yagaf-hahog: casvan-fraath-praath-novwyn-prair-eliath

Action item from the Tornwick incident review: the secrets-rotation utility (Keyturn) silently skipped services with stale manifests, leaving expired credentials live. Contractor task: add a hard failure on skipped entries and a rotation audit report. Target: end of sprint. Setup instructions, manifest format, and acceptance criteria are on the internal page here.

dashboard of tawef-hagug = https://superset.norvadyn.local/display/projects/build/ticket/build/spaces/ticket/1e989f0e6c200d20fc4ae06b

Heads up: the `keyshuffle` rotation utility is mostly hands-off, but it will pause mid-rotation if any service on the Pellwright cluster fails its health check. Don't just rerun it — a half-rotated secret is worse than a stale one. Check the rotation log, confirm which services picked up the new value, then resume. The step-by-step recovery guide is on the page below.

wiki page, tahaf-tajog: https://jira.ordindyn.corp/pipeline